COURS DE PROGRAMMATION ORIENTEE OBJET

icon

45

pages

icon

Documents

Écrit par

Publié par

Lire un extrait
Lire un extrait

Obtenez un accès à la bibliothèque pour le consulter en ligne En savoir plus

Découvre YouScribe en t'inscrivant gratuitement

Je m'inscris

Découvre YouScribe en t'inscrivant gratuitement

Je m'inscris
icon

45

pages

icon

Documents

Lire un extrait
Lire un extrait

Obtenez un accès à la bibliothèque pour le consulter en ligne En savoir plus

Niveau: Supérieur, Licence, Bac+3
345 COURS DE PROGRAMMATION ORIENTEE OBJET : Les collections en Java 346 2 - Bibliothèque de Collections JAVA La bibliothèque standard de Java fournit des implantations de TAD classiques qu'il suffit ensuite de savoir utiliser de manière adaptée en fonction du problème.

  • classe abstraite

  • risques de collections

  • bibliothèque standard de java

  • implantations de tad classiques

  • collections java

  • public boolean


Voir icon arrow

Publié par

Nombre de lectures

71

COURS DE PROGRAMMATION ORIENTEE OBJET :
Les collections en Java
2 - Bibliothèque de Collections JAV
345
La bibliothèque standard de Java fournit des implantations de TAD classiques qu’il suffit ensuite de savoir utiliser de manière adaptée en fonction du problème.
346
2 - Bibliothèque de Collections JAV Définitions – Unecollectionest un conteneur d’objets
– Uncadre(framework) définit un certain nombre • d’interfaces • de classes abstraites • de mécanismes.
347
2 - Bibliothèque de Collections JAV Définitions – La bibliothèque de collections Java constitueun cadre pour des classes de collections. – Ce cadre définit • des interfaces • des classes abstraites pour implanter les collections • un protocole d’itération.
348
2 - Bibliothèque de Collections JAV Définitions – Avec le JDK 5.0, les classes et les interfaces sont devenuesgénériques avec paramètre de type. – Avantages : permet d’écrire un code • plus sûr (plus de risques de collections hétérogènes) et • plus facile à lire car plus de transtypage – Si on utilise une version antérieure de Java, il faut ignorer les paramètres de type et remplacer les types génériques par le type Object.349
COLLECTIONS JAVA Les interfaces – Le cadre est composé de10 interfacesdéfinies dans le paquetage java.util.
– Il existe deux interfaces fondamentales pour les conteneurs: Collection Map
350
COLLECTIONS JAVA
Les interfaces
Queue
Deque
Collection
List
COLLECTIONS JAVA Les interfaces
Map
SortedMap
Set
SortedSet
Iterator
ListIterator
351
352
Voir icon more
Alternate Text